Precision Actuator Signal Management
The Woodward 5464-211 module integrates and drives actuator signals within turbine control systems. This critical component from the 5400 Series delivers precise current and voltage to actuators. Furthermore, it ensures seamless signal processing for reliable turbine operation across various load conditions.
Robust Communication and Monitoring Features
This driver module supports the Modbus RTU and Modbus ASCII protocols for communication. It continuously monitors actuator performance to detect potential faults proactively. Consequently, it enhances system reliability by providing real-time diagnostic feedback directly to the main controller for immediate action.
Key Technical Specifications and Physical Data
Below are the detailed technical and physical parameters for the Woodward 5464-211. These specifications are essential for proper cabinet layout and electrical system design.
| Specification | Detail |
|---|---|
| Manufacturer & Model | Woodward 5464-211 |
| Product Series | 5400 Series Turbine Control |
| Primary Function | Actuator Signal Integration & Driving |
| Input Voltage Range | 10 – 60 VDC |
| Nominal Voltage | 24 VDC |
| Operating Temperature | -25°C to +70°C |
| Dimensions (H x W x D) | 30 cm x 20 cm x 25 cm |
| Weight | 0.73 kg |
| Supported Protocols | Modbus RTU, Modbus ASCII |
| Key Capability | Actuator Fault Detection & Monitoring |
Dedicated Signal Driving and Protection
The module provides isolated output channels to protect the control system from actuator feedback issues. It can drive multiple actuators simultaneously, managing both position and speed control signals. This capability is crucial for the precise fuel and air management required in gas or steam turbines.
